TM 10-1670-292-23&P                                                         0011 00 0011 00-13 (4)  Replace connector links on tension plate. c.    Twists.  A twist occurs when the suspension lines within one group become improperly crossed. NOTE Insert packing weight around lines 1 and 15 while working on lines 16 and 30. (1) To remove twists, grasp the top and bottom inside lines (lines 1 and 30) at the skirt of canopy and trace them to the connector links.
